>> I think there is one possible improvement with boxed primitive types:
for the moment we want to use only SLF4J api (as a consequence, we're
aiming for a low allocation rate, but not necessarily no allocation at
all), so the "Unboxer" mecanism provided in log4j is not an option for us
to deal with primitive types.
>> Is this possible in a future release to have a special cases in
ParameterFormatter.appendSpecialTypes() for boxed primitive types ?
Currently, when using parametrized message with both Object and primitive
parameters, I haven't find a "SLF4J-compatible" way to avoid this
allocation when formatting.
>
>
> If I understand correctly, you're less concerned with the varargs and the
auto-boxed primitives, but would like to avoid calling toString() on the
objects that resulted from the auto-boxing (please correct me if I
misunderstood). Is something like the below what you have in mind? Would
you mind raising a feature request on the Log4j2 issue tracker for this?
>
> private static boolean appendSpecialTypes(final Object o, final
StringBuilder str) {
>
>     ...
>     } else if (o instanceof Long) {
>         str.append(((Long) o).longValue());
>         return true;
>
>     } else if (o instanceof Integer) {
>         str.append(((Integer) o).intValue());
>
>         return true;
>
>     } else if (o instanceof Double) {
>         str.append(((Double) o).doubleValue());
>
>         return true;
>     } // similarly for float, short and boolean.
>     ...
>
> }
